These days, people in Tu Xa commune, Lam Thao district, are busy planting, caring for, and harvesting winter vegetables to supply the market. The bustling, joyful atmosphere of production is present throughout the fields, in each stage of safe green vegetable production.

A corner of Tu Xa commune, Lam Thao district.

Warm weather creates favorable conditions for farmers to carry out concentrated production.

Looking down from above, the vegetable beds create a colorful picture.

In the cool green, people are happy because this production season is relatively favorable.

Tu Xa is the largest vegetable growing area in the province, so the working atmosphere has also become more hurried and bustling.

Farmers in Tu Xa harvest vegetables twice a day in the morning and late afternoon.

Vegetables, tubers, and fruits are harvested alternately, with the correct quantity and quality according to the purchasing unit’s requirements.

Partly with good harvests and partly with good prices, vegetable growers are very excited.

Vegetables are gathered and transferred to the preliminary processing area.

On the rows of vegetables that have just been harvested, people immediately plow the soil and fertilize to prepare for planting the next crop.

Thanks to vegetables, many farmers in Tu Xa have built spacious houses.

With production linked to the value chain, cooperatives in the area have stable revenue, contributing to job creation and increasing income for farmers.

Vegetables after harvest are processed according to the correct standards.

Affixed with traceability stamps, ready to be transported to agents.

The clean vegetable rows in Tu Xa have helped improve the material and spiritual lives of the people, actively contributing to the construction of a model new rural commune as well as building advanced new rural areas in the locality.
